View MoreBlue Topaz Jewellery
Dating back to first century when the Jewish historian Josephus revealed a connection among the twelve months of the year, the twelve zodiac signs, and the twelve different stones in Aaron's breastplate, birthstones are gemstones that have come to represent an individual's month of birth. Formed in all different varieties, topaz is a gemstone or silicate mineral of aluminum and fluorine that crystallizes in the vapor cavities of lava flows, such as those situated at Utah's Topaz Mountain. Though there are many different colours, blue topaz is the gemstone that represents the birth month of December.Blue topaz is also the state gemstone of Texas in the United States. The rarity of the naturally occurring gemstone and it's colour, though commonly heat treated to emphasize it's vibrancy as a darker blue, makes it a particularly special stone. Second only to the emerald, blue topaz has made its way towards becoming the most popular commercially-demanded gemstone. Its hardness, attractive quality, and relative affordability also make it a popular choice for personal jewellery, particularly the blue topaz birthstone ring.
